In average, 88%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Nau vs Sacramento State. The average financial aid amount received is $11,940. For all undergraduate students, 75.50%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$11,539
The average tuition & fees for the schools is $10,319 for state residents and $20,331 for out-of-state students. The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Nau vs Sacramento State is $43,084 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$31,144.
